One of the top 3 north end restaurants in my book. They are really friendly and genuinely interested in making sure you have a great experience. Go for the veal osso bucco it is outstanding. The saffron risotto and crunchy carrots pair so well with the veal that it’s a truly amazing taste, texture and aroma combination. Some of pastas are also spectacular the egg yolk and cheese ravioli is a go to for us. There are some interesting drinks on the menu and good wines. Strongly recommend the espresso martini one of the best I’ve had. Roast pork was good and the gnocchi bolognaise was outstanding great flavour and texture. The Bronzino is good if you like fish. Dessert however does not match up to the standard of food here it’s not bad but the bar is set way higher by the mains and the sweet course underwhelms. Not a worry as in north end there are many ways to satisfy that craving.
